From mboxrd@z Thu Jan 1 00:00:00 1970 From: Steven Rostedt Subject: [PATCH 7/7 v2] tracing: Do not create tracefs files if tracefs lockdown is in effect Date: Fri, 11 Oct 2019 20:57:54 -0400 Message-ID: <20191012005921.580293464@goodmis.org> References: <20191012005747.210722465@goodmis.org> Mime-Version: 1.0 Content-Type: text/plain; charset=UTF-8 Return-path: Sender: linux-kernel-owner@vger.kernel.org To: linux-kernel@vger.kernel.org Cc: Linus Torvalds , Ingo Molnar , Andrew Morton , Matthew Garrett , James Morris James Morris , LSM List , Linux API , Ben Hutchings , Al Viro List-Id: linux-api@vger.kernel.org From: "Steven Rostedt (VMware)" If on boot up, lockdown is activated for tracefs, don't even bother creating the files. This can also prevent instances from being created if lockdown is in effect. Link: http://lkml.kernel.org/r/CAHk-=whC6Ji=fWnjh2+eS4b15TnbsS4VPVtvBOwCy1jjEG_JHQ@mail.gmail.com Suggested-by: Linus Torvalds Signed-off-by: Steven Rostedt (VMware) --- fs/tracefs/inode.c | 4 ++++ 1 file changed, 4 insertions(+) diff --git a/fs/tracefs/inode.c b/fs/tracefs/inode.c index eeeae0475da9..0caa151cae4e 100644 --- a/fs/tracefs/inode.c +++ b/fs/tracefs/inode.c @@ -16,6 +16,7 @@ #include #include #include +#include #include #include #include @@ -390,6 +391,9 @@ struct dentry *tracefs_create_file(const char *name, umode_t mode, struct dentry *dentry; struct inode *inode; + if (security_locked_down(LOCKDOWN_TRACEFS)) + return NULL; + if (!(mode & S_IFMT)) mode |= S_IFREG; BUG_ON(!S_ISREG(mode)); -- 2.23.0
